NEW YORK, NY – WEBTOON Entertainment and The Walt Disney Company unveiled an ambitious new slate of reformatted comic series and original webcomics at New York Comic Con (NYCC) 2025, held from October 9-12. The announcement deepens their strategic partnership, aiming to transform iconic stories from Disney, Marvel, Star Wars, and 20th Century Studios into mobile-friendly, vertical-scroll formats for a global audience.
The collaboration not only expands the existing library of adapted titles but also introduces a new digital comics platform and includes Disney’s planned acquisition of a 2% equity interest in WEBTOON Entertainment, signaling a significant commitment to the burgeoning digital comics market.
Broadening the Digital Canvas: New Reformatted Titles Revealed
Fans can anticipate a diverse “next wave” of beloved series joining the WEBTOON platform, providing a fresh vertical-scroll experience for classic narratives. These additions build upon previously launched reformatted titles such as Amazing Spider-Man (2022-present), Avengers (2012), Star Wars (2015), Alien (2021), and Disney As Old As Time: A Twisted Tale.
The newly announced reformatted series include:
- Astonishing X-Men (2004)
- The Unbeatable Squirrel Girl
- Stitch Samurai: The Complete Collection
- Star Wars: Darth Vader – Black, White & Red
- Star Wars: Lost Stars
These titles aim to captivate both long-time fans and new readers by delivering beloved stories in a format optimized for mobile devices.
Original Webcomic Series and Expanded Universes
Beyond reformatting existing comics, the partnership is also fostering the creation of brand-new original webcomic series based on Disney, Marvel, Star Wars, and 20th Century Studios properties. These original narratives are designed to introduce fresh adventures and expand the universes of fan-favorite characters.
Among the original series teased at NYCC 2025 are:
- Arendelle Chronicles: A Frozen spin-off exploring the kingdom through the eyes of royal guards, merchants, and forest inhabitants before Elsa’s reign.
- Star Command: The Early Years: An origin story featuring a young Buzz Lightyear, drawing on Toy Story‘s classic style, depicting his academy life and early galactic threats.
- A Disney Villains Team-Up Comic: Promised to be a darker, edgier take, allowing iconic villains to collaborate in new, unexpected ways.
These original webcomics represent a strategic move to offer deeper dives into established worlds and characters, catering to a mobile-native generation.
A Unified Digital Comics Platform and Disney’s Investment
A significant development stemming from this collaboration is the planned creation of an all-new digital comics platform. This platform is set to integrate over 35,000 comics from Disney’s extensive portfolio, including Marvel, Star Wars, Pixar, and 20th Century Studios, into a single subscription service. The service will support both the vertical-scroll format popularized by WEBTOON and traditional comic book layouts.
As part of the broader Disney+ Perks program, Disney+ subscribers will gain exclusive access to a curated selection of comic titles within this new app at no additional charge, enhancing the value proposition for existing subscribers and drawing new users into the digital comics ecosystem. This initiative expands upon Marvel Unlimited, Marvel’s current digital comics service, by incorporating a wider array of Disney content and select WEBTOON Original stories.
The partnership underscores a larger trend of digital innovation in the comics industry, driven by the increasing demand for accessible digital content and WEBTOON’s expansive global user base, with approximately 85.6 million monthly users worldwide, 75% of whom are under 34 years old. Disney’s planned 2% equity stake in WEBTOON Entertainment further solidifies this alliance, reflecting strong investor confidence and a long-term vision for the companies’ joint future in digital storytelling.
The Future of Storytelling: Engaging New Audiences
Both WEBTOON and Disney emphasize that the collaboration aims to revolutionize how fans engage with their favorite stories and characters. By combining Disney’s legendary storytelling prowess with WEBTOON’s expertise in mobile-friendly, vertical-scroll comics, the partnership seeks to introduce iconic franchises to a new generation of mobile-native fans and provide existing fans with novel ways to experience beloved series.
This multi-year collaboration, initially announced in August 2025, is poised to create a seamless ecosystem that connects comics, movies, and streaming, leveraging the strengths of both entertainment giants to expand their intellectual properties across diverse media and reach wider demographics.
